Manage the entire life-cycle of multiple localization projects, coordinating phases, liaising with sales, negotiating with vendors, and maintaining project documentation.
Manage the entire life-cycle of multiple localization projects in a fast-paced environment
Coordinate all the project phases and efficiently predict the lifespan of all the stages of the project
Liaise with sales staff to clarify project parameters
Negotiate deadlines and rates with vendors
Establish and maintain excellent relationships with contract translators and proofreaders globally
Monitor and control projects status
Manage project finances, including budgeting
Prepare and maintain project documentation
Comply with relevant and applicable procedures
Perform quality checks at various stages of process to ensure quality and accuracy (proofreading, final eye…)
Excellent written and verbal English communication skills, other languages would be an asset
University Degree (preferably in linguistic/translation related studies)
Minimum 1 year of professional experience in a similar position in corporate environment
Detail orientation with the ability to multitask
Ability to meet deadlines
Excellent problem solving and analytical skills
Independence in carrying out assigned tasks
Ability to work under pressure in a fast-paced environment
Highly-developed computer skills (MS Office, Windows)
Experience in translation and localization project management would be a strong advantage
TransPerfect builds comprehensive language and technology solutions, specializing in translation, localization, and game services to support global businesses. Their distinctive approach combines high-quality linguistic services with innovative technology, enabling effective communication in over 170 languages across various industries.
